PumpSwap: Graduation from Pump.fun

Pump.fun uses an on‑chain bonding curve to bootstrap new tokens. Every token starts trading against a constant‑product AMM curve managed by Pump.fun, not on a public DEX orderbook.(pump.fun)

Raydium: AMM, CPMM, and CLMM

Raydium supports multiple liquidity models:(github.com)

  1. Legacy AMM / AMM v4
  2. Standard constant‑product pools spanning 0 → ∞ price range.
  3. Good for volatile pairs and simple LPing.

  4. CPMM (constant‑product market maker) with additional parameters

  5. Variants tuned for different fee tiers and routing behavior.

  6. CLMM (Concentrated Liquidity Market Maker)

  7. LPs choose a price range where their liquidity is active, similar to Uniswap v3.(github.com)
  8. Within that range, effective depth is much higher for the same capital, which translates to tighter spreads and lower price impact for traders.(docs.venum.dev)

Pump.fun + PumpSwap Fees

Pump.fun’s bonding curve charges a 1.25% trading fee on curve trades, split between the creator and protocol.(pump.fun)
The docs note that post‑graduation PumpSwap fees differ, but do not publish a detailed public schedule in the same document.(pump.fun)

When to Use PumpSwap vs Raydium: Concrete Scenarios

Use PumpSwap When…

  1. You’re sniping fresh Pump.fun graduates
  2. The token just hit the graduation threshold and moved from the bonding curve to PumpSwap.
  3. Raydium liquidity either doesn’t exist yet or is a thin mirror of the PumpSwap pool.

  4. You’re trading very small size on pure memes

  5. You’re comfortable with high fees and slippage in exchange for early entry.
  6. Your thesis is purely short‑term momentum, not fundamentals.

  7. You want to stay within the Pump.fun ecosystem

  8. You’re using tools that specifically track Pump.fun launches and PumpSwap graduates.
  9. You accept that many tokens will never migrate to deeper venues like Raydium.

Use Raydium When…

  1. You’re trading established Solana assets
  2. SOL/USDC, SOL/wstETH, major LSTs, and memecoins that survived their first weeks.
  3. You care about tight spreads and low price impact, especially on CLMM pools.

  4. You want aggregator‑optimized execution

  5. You’re routing via Jupiter or another aggregator that taps Raydium CLMM/CPMM and OpenBook.
  6. You want the best available route across multiple venues, not just PumpSwap.

  7. You’re providing liquidity, not just trading

  8. Raydium’s CLMM lets you concentrate liquidity in a price range and earn higher fee APR if you manage your ranges actively.(github.com)
  9. There are more external tools (Kamino, analytics dashboards, tax software) that understand Raydium CLMM/CPMM positions.(reddit.com)

  10. You care about longer‑term positioning

  11. For anything beyond short‑term meme rotations, Raydium’s deeper markets and orderbook integration are structurally more robust.
